Juha Haavisto is a historian specializing in early modern political and economic thought, with a focus on governance, trade and the intellectual foundations of prosperity. His research explores how ideas of human nature, statecraft and economic policy shaped seventeenth-century debates on stability and progress. Holding a doctoral degree from the European University Institute, Haavisto has studied early modern intellectual history. In Economics, Politics and Prosperity, Haavisto offers a revisionist interpretation of William Temple, demonstrating Temple’s significance in the evolution of political and economic thought in early modern Europe.
